Class MigrateProcessInstanceRequest
java.lang.Object
io.camunda.zeebe.gateway.protocol.rest.MigrateProcessInstanceRequest
@Generated(value="org.openapitools.codegen.languages.SpringCodegen",
date="2024-10-11T17:26:39.504605721Z[GMT]",
comments="Generator version: 7.8.0")
public class MigrateProcessInstanceRequest
extends Object
MigrateProcessInstanceRequest
-
Constructor Summary
ConstructorsConstructorDescriptionMigrateProcessInstanceRequest(Long targetProcessDefinitionKey, List<@Valid MigrateProcessInstanceMappingInstruction> mappingInstructions) Constructor with only required parameters -
Method Summary
Modifier and TypeMethodDescriptionaddMappingInstructionsItem(MigrateProcessInstanceMappingInstruction mappingInstructionsItem) boolean@NotNull @Valid List<@Valid MigrateProcessInstanceMappingInstruction> Get mappingInstructions@Min(1L) LongA reference key chosen by the user that will be part of all records resulting from this operation.@NotNull LongThe key of process definition to migrate the process instance to.inthashCode()mappingInstructions(List<@Valid MigrateProcessInstanceMappingInstruction> mappingInstructions) operationReference(Long operationReference) voidsetMappingInstructions(List<@Valid MigrateProcessInstanceMappingInstruction> mappingInstructions) voidsetOperationReference(Long operationReference) voidsetTargetProcessDefinitionKey(Long targetProcessDefinitionKey) targetProcessDefinitionKey(Long targetProcessDefinitionKey) toString()
-
Constructor Details
-
MigrateProcessInstanceRequest
public MigrateProcessInstanceRequest() -
MigrateProcessInstanceRequest
public MigrateProcessInstanceRequest(Long targetProcessDefinitionKey, List<@Valid MigrateProcessInstanceMappingInstruction> mappingInstructions) Constructor with only required parameters
-
-
Method Details
-
targetProcessDefinitionKey
-
getTargetProcessDefinitionKey
The key of process definition to migrate the process instance to.- Returns:
- targetProcessDefinitionKey
-
setTargetProcessDefinitionKey
-
mappingInstructions
public MigrateProcessInstanceRequest mappingInstructions(List<@Valid MigrateProcessInstanceMappingInstruction> mappingInstructions) -
addMappingInstructionsItem
public MigrateProcessInstanceRequest addMappingInstructionsItem(MigrateProcessInstanceMappingInstruction mappingInstructionsItem) -
getMappingInstructions
@NotNull @Valid public @NotNull @Valid List<@Valid MigrateProcessInstanceMappingInstruction> getMappingInstructions()Get mappingInstructions- Returns:
- mappingInstructions
-
setMappingInstructions
public void setMappingInstructions(List<@Valid MigrateProcessInstanceMappingInstruction> mappingInstructions) -
operationReference
-
getOperationReference
A reference key chosen by the user that will be part of all records resulting from this operation. Must be > 0 if provided. minimum: 1- Returns:
- operationReference
-
setOperationReference
-
equals
-
hashCode
public int hashCode() -
toString
-